Commit Graph

  • ed37f1d01b gitignore: add env.sh and riscv-tools-install Bastian Koppelmann 2019-05-31 17:31:26 +02:00
  • 5ef1d449aa gitmodules: now only use https instead of ssh Bastian Koppelmann 2019-05-31 17:30:10 +02:00
  • d9a82e914c Bump FireSim David Biancolin 2019-05-29 22:29:24 +00:00
  • f4fb0c42b1 Fix a number of build.sbt related problems David Biancolin 2019-05-29 22:26:04 +00:00
  • 0cb1608e2c Bump FireSim David Biancolin 2019-05-29 15:34:56 +00:00
  • 401a2b9da4 Update setup scripts David Biancolin 2019-05-29 15:31:33 +00:00
  • e379a09dfd Merge pull request #103 from ucb-bar/rebar-dev Abraham Gonzalez 2019-05-28 23:11:37 -07:00
  • 8a611bde0b Merge pull request #102 from ucb-bar/rebar-dev-setup-fix Abraham Gonzalez 2019-05-28 23:05:45 -07:00
  • 3a1dbf8983 make sure code blocks appear abejgonzalez 2019-05-28 23:04:53 -07:00
  • 819a11a3ba Merge pull request #101 from ucb-bar/rebar-dev Abraham Gonzalez 2019-05-28 22:57:24 -07:00
  • 57a471e21e Merge pull request #100 from ucb-bar/rebar-dev-setup-repo Abraham Gonzalez 2019-05-28 22:55:58 -07:00
  • 194dd1917a add initial setup instructions abejgonzalez 2019-05-28 22:48:40 -07:00
  • ef65be6c78 Merge pull request #98 from ucb-bar/rebar-dev-readme Abraham Gonzalez 2019-05-28 21:11:52 -07:00
  • baf7a6c30d Bump FireSim David Biancolin 2019-05-29 00:50:40 +00:00
  • 92a7e70750 fix rocketchip link abejgonzalez 2019-05-28 17:42:05 -07:00
  • a4010bc512 Update README (mainly just have links to the documentation) abejgonzalez 2019-05-28 16:08:35 -07:00
  • a53abf1856 Bring up FireSim tests David Biancolin 2019-05-28 22:51:39 +00:00
  • dfdeadf96f Merge remote-tracking branch 'origin/rebar-dev' Abraham Gonzalez 2019-05-28 14:21:57 -07:00
  • 767e59f382 Merge pull request #95 from ucb-bar/rebar-dev-multirocc Abraham Gonzalez 2019-05-28 14:14:08 -07:00
  • fa080b7857 fix top level naming abejgonzalez 2019-05-28 12:46:57 -07:00
  • 4ad54ced98 use varargs instead of seq abejgonzalez 2019-05-26 17:44:27 -07:00
  • 41b4637c29 build and name hwacha correctly abejgonzalez 2019-05-24 21:13:14 -07:00
  • 7e6591b5ea add multi-rocc and show small example abejgonzalez 2019-05-24 17:58:12 -07:00
  • c5c446f83b Merge pull request #93 from ucb-bar/rebar-dev-default-sim-flags Abraham Gonzalez 2019-05-28 11:25:04 -07:00
  • 45cacd526f Merge pull request #92 from ucb-bar/rebar-dev-heter-multicore Abraham Gonzalez 2019-05-28 11:24:35 -07:00
  • ddc962bb26 Merge pull request #96 from ucb-bar/rebar-dev-docs-update Abraham Gonzalez 2019-05-27 20:11:03 -07:00
  • 540afea07a fix config naming abejgonzalez 2019-05-27 19:12:07 -07:00
  • c160f597b7 spelling check | better heading for accelerators abejgonzalez 2019-05-27 19:07:55 -07:00
  • 2a58f387ed Fix some test suite handling David Biancolin 2019-05-28 01:50:39 +00:00
  • d51ab9cde6 only change default SIM_FLAGS | revert .run and .out flags abejgonzalez 2019-05-27 17:26:44 -07:00
  • ee62fa8bac renamed classes to BoomRocket to clarify | clearer comments | readd the bmark timeout abejgonzalez 2019-05-27 17:21:19 -07:00
  • 3b14ac8706 minor fixes to links | misc cleanup Abraham Gonzalez 2019-05-27 17:11:10 -07:00
  • c0d4e848ba WIP David Biancolin 2019-05-27 22:53:05 +00:00
  • 0f34247378 add section on where to find verilog abejgonzalez 2019-05-27 15:51:25 -07:00
  • dde22a969b add more to docs | 1st spelling pass | more links | proper formatting abejgonzalez 2019-05-27 15:29:09 -07:00
  • c19855bfa6 shared heter-subsystem | single example SUB_PROJECT abejgonzalez 2019-05-26 15:46:19 -07:00
  • c341ffe57d remove verbose for default abejgonzalez 2019-05-24 21:22:46 -07:00
  • 08dd5b5375 update boom to master abejgonzalez 2019-05-24 17:37:16 -07:00
  • 4af9ea9846 make default flags include timeout | all sims share flags abejgonzalez 2019-05-24 09:47:50 -07:00
  • 5408d6ecbe bump boom abejgonzalez 2019-05-23 22:58:28 -07:00
  • f071b522b2 ci harness fix for boomexample abejgonzalez 2019-05-23 22:01:50 -07:00
  • 6d622e7555 add boomrocketexample to ci abejgonzalez 2019-05-23 22:00:04 -07:00
  • 612aa48e65 remove extra imports abejgonzalez 2019-05-23 21:51:42 -07:00
  • 9182c1394a update boom | fix comments and remove extra code abejgonzalez 2019-05-23 21:46:37 -07:00
  • 838a34be51 move subsystem to boom | misc cleanup | bump boom abejgonzalez 2019-05-23 19:26:08 -07:00
  • e538e333a5 updated boom for fixes \ better printf abejgonzalez 2019-05-21 10:47:24 -07:00
  • cae63ad13f working heterogenous cores abejgonzalez 2019-05-20 23:29:48 -07:00
  • 8b3fef85ce first attempt at heter. port abejgonzalez 2019-05-20 17:44:47 -07:00
  • bc54b24b85 Merge pull request #84 from ucb-bar/rebar-rc-may Jerry Zhao 2019-05-22 11:04:01 -07:00
  • 1bf27d0fa9 Bump boom Jerry Zhao 2019-05-21 22:05:20 -07:00
  • ad2703605d Merge pull request #91 from ucb-bar/rebar-dev-renaming-help Abraham Gonzalez 2019-05-21 10:44:48 -07:00
  • cc0d33ee4d updated permissive naming | small bugfix for vcd/vpd dumping abejgonzalez 2019-05-20 17:19:46 -07:00
  • 30d54a6851 readme addition | pipe out output | renamed output files abejgonzalez 2019-05-20 17:12:22 -07:00
  • 65d6a900c3 rename output | helper rules to run binaries abejgonzalez 2019-05-20 16:15:08 -07:00
  • 6177191eed Merge pull request #88 from ucb-bar/rebar-dev-utility-speedup Abraham Gonzalez 2019-05-19 00:54:35 -07:00
  • 206221323c Bump hwacha Jerry Zhao 2019-05-17 18:36:59 -07:00
  • 408dbcafa2 Bump barstools Jerry Zhao 2019-05-17 18:26:00 -07:00
  • a7a4dd345b Bump to May rocketchip | Support for BigInt mems Jerry Zhao 2019-05-13 13:25:58 -07:00
  • 7e1365f142 more docs skeleton alonamid 2019-05-17 14:33:58 -07:00
  • fa1c4ae221 reduce amount of sbt calls for sim abejgonzalez 2019-05-16 22:57:18 -07:00
  • e0aed90714 subtitles alonamid 2019-05-16 00:45:46 -07:00
  • d091fe8b22 fix docs alonamid 2019-05-16 00:41:33 -07:00
  • f5c191871d more docs alonamid 2019-05-16 00:26:32 -07:00
  • a7822e1190 Merge pull request #82 from ucb-bar/ci-setup Abraham Gonzalez 2019-05-15 15:57:35 -07:00
  • e0e1acdd57 Bump barstools to master merged commit Colin Schmidt 2019-05-15 10:07:41 -07:00
  • 86e2e5c458 docs theme alonamid 2019-05-14 22:53:04 -07:00
  • 2ca18a4408 docs alonamid 2019-05-14 22:44:54 -07:00
  • 04c5fcf350 readthedocs fix alonamid 2019-05-14 22:16:29 -07:00
  • 9f4fdccf5d readthedocs config alonamid 2019-05-14 22:13:50 -07:00
  • e007b49179 bump rocket-chip to enable large memory spaces (#76) Colin Schmidt 2019-05-14 10:22:31 -07:00
  • 82636b3ff4 Upstream MemConf and use it (with some slight tweaks) John Wright 2019-03-05 15:01:44 -08:00
  • c23b2b6f84 SRAM depth to bigint Colin Schmidt 2019-05-02 14:36:57 -07:00
  • deccae4959 hwacha depends on esp-tools | support java args abejgonzalez 2019-05-13 17:17:32 -07:00
  • 59acd688e6 clearer job naming for verilog only hwacha abejgonzalez 2019-05-13 14:16:11 -07:00
  • 7ba56b58d3 for now just support verilog build of hwacha (no tests run on it) abejgonzalez 2019-05-13 14:15:05 -07:00
  • a377c520a6 smaller rocket For hwacha ci abejgonzalez 2019-05-13 13:34:29 -07:00
  • 1226591231 use example config for hwacha (otherwise use other hwacha params) abejgonzalez 2019-05-13 10:27:36 -07:00
  • 2d644f1352 make hwacha smaller abejgonzalez 2019-05-13 09:50:55 -07:00
  • 2697cdc29b add small config string to config.yml Abraham Gonzalez 2019-05-12 14:09:12 -07:00
  • e1292fdfa8 revert to smaller boom config and support in ci Abraham Gonzalez 2019-05-12 13:11:06 -07:00
  • b2d46037a5 add status badge for master | add ci readme | add more benchmark tests Abraham Gonzalez 2019-05-12 12:16:10 -07:00
  • e35d299ad4 store all source/collateral when moving to test run Abraham Gonzalez 2019-05-11 20:31:00 -07:00
  • 1a6a5ea875 correct dependencies for runs Abraham Gonzalez 2019-05-11 18:55:04 -07:00
  • 8f3426362d need riscv-tools for verilator build Abraham Gonzalez 2019-05-11 18:52:13 -07:00
  • 9f7f94b6f9 parallelize toolchain builds with verilator Abraham Gonzalez 2019-05-11 18:35:34 -07:00
  • e109831b0b more renaming | proper place to git submodule update Abraham Gonzalez 2019-05-11 18:23:38 -07:00
  • 1ef687605d remove old boom references | build-toolchain rebar directory fix Abraham Gonzalez 2019-05-11 17:43:20 -07:00
  • 2259952087 rename the workflow Abraham Gonzalez 2019-05-11 17:33:06 -07:00
  • 2dbe087fce have toolchain script point to rebar correctly Abraham Gonzalez 2019-05-11 17:29:10 -07:00
  • e5d9f539c5 initial ci commit Abraham Gonzalez 2019-05-11 17:16:32 -07:00
  • d0128d8f24 Merge pull request #83 from ucb-bar/rebar-verisim-fix Abraham Gonzalez 2019-05-11 20:03:39 -07:00
  • 340ed90652 Remove permissive flag for verisim Jerry Zhao 2019-05-11 19:59:49 -07:00
  • 0caf108d33 Merge pull request #81 from ucb-bar/rebar-dev-verisim-fix Abraham Gonzalez 2019-05-11 17:31:37 -07:00
  • 462d3de5c9 Fix pointer to emulator.cc in GenerateSimFiles Jerry Zhao 2019-05-11 17:14:09 -07:00
  • 0d6a23b1b5 Merge pull request #80 from ucb-bar/rebar-bootrom-fix Jerry Zhao 2019-05-11 14:27:26 -07:00
  • a4d4101cf4 Fix bootrom symlink, update .gitignore to only ignore bootrom directory Jerry Zhao 2019-05-11 13:26:31 -07:00
  • 01067df07e Update build.sbt with correct locations of example/utilities Jerry Zhao 2019-05-10 21:09:00 -07:00
  • 533839cb0f Merge pull request #79 from ucb-bar/rebar_reorg Jerry Zhao 2019-05-10 18:40:20 -07:00
  • ca3678087c Add verilator_install make target for CI purposes Jerry Zhao 2019-05-10 17:06:03 -07:00
  • db8b8f50cf Move example/utilities to generator directory Jerry Zhao 2019-05-10 15:29:28 -07:00